However, it is critically important to address the substantial concerns highlighted in public reviews, which are integral to understanding the actual living experience:

  • Severe Maintenance Neglect: Reviews indicate significant and persistent issues, including long-standing unaddressed problems like leaking windows and mold growth, causing damage to property and potential health hazards. There are claims of management failing to enforce basic upkeep like grass cutting and cleanliness, requiring intervention from code enforcement.
  • Aggressive and Threatening Behavior from Tenants: One review describes a tenant engaging in repeated aggressive acts, including shooting at a window (while a vulnerable resident was present), repeated intrusions by a dog into a fenced yard, and threatening behavior towards a neighbor after dark. This points to a severe lack of safety and community standard enforcement.
  • Graffiti and Property Value Decline: Reports of spray-painted graffiti, including offensive content, directly facing neighboring homes and remaining for over a year, suggest a disregard for property appearance and a negative impact on surrounding property values.
  • Management Unresponsiveness and Disrespect: Multiple reviews heavily criticize the management. Claims include:
    • Management being "never in the office."
    • Calling the police on tenants who try to speak to them at their homes.
    • Cursing at tenants.
    • Not fixing things for tenants ("maintenance doesn't fix things for the tenants").
    • Disregard for tenant well-being and safety.
    • Accusations of staff being "drunks" and "take advantage of you," breaking lease rules themselves while strictly enforcing them on others.
  • Lack of Safety and Enforcement: There are explicit statements that management "don't keep safe renters" and fail to enforce rules like "no fires" from the rental contract. Animal control repeatedly having to visit also points to a lack of pet policy enforcement.
  • Overall Deterioration of the Park: Reviews state that "the whole trailer park has gone to trash" and that "this was a fairly decent area to live, but the managers here have ruined that."
